Bumblebee is an Autobot from the live-action film continuity family. He is also known as N.B.E.-02.
"Groovy, bee-otch!"

Bumblebee is one of Optimus Prime's most trusted lieutenants. Although he is not the strongest or most powerful of the Autobots, Bumblebee more than makes up for this with a bottomless well of luck, determination and bravery. He would gladly give his life to protect others and stop the Decepticons.

Badly damaged in battle, Bumblebee lost the ability to speak verbally, though he can still communicate over inter-Autobot frequencies (in a fashion that seems somewhat akin to instant messaging, a usable but more distant and less personal means of interaction).

Bumblebee, having made his way to a second-rate car dealership, became Sam Witwicky's first car. Sam's father promised his son a car if Sam paid half of the money and achieved three A's in school. After doing so with the help of his genealogy project, Sam rode with his father to a car lot with an exceedingly long name. Following them to the lot, Bumblebee quietly placed himself among the other cars. To prevent Sam from having to choose another car, he used a high-frequency sound wave to blow out the windows of every other car in the lot, leaving Bobby Bolivia with no choice but to sell Bumblebee to the Witwickys.

The next day, Sam and his friend Miles Lancaster drove Bumblebee down to the lake in a misguided attempt to impress the popular girls at a party. Observing the exchange of thinly veiled insults between Sam and the football jocks, Bumblebee decided to help out Sam when the boy noticed Mikaela Banes walking home after a falling-out with her now ex-boyfriend. Playing "Drive" on his radio, Bumblebee inspired Sam to kick Miles out and drive Mikaela home. As the two awkwardly chatted, Bumblebee suddenly turned off his engine when they neared a romantic spot overlooking the city, this time playing "Sexual Healing" and "I Feel Good". Not knowing his car has a mind of its own, Sam misinterpreted this as a breakdown. Mikaela attempted to fix Bumblebee with her mechanical know-how, only to leave after Sam asked her why she tolerated jerks like her ex-boyfriend. Trying to help as much as he could, Bumblebee allowed Sam to start up his engine as she walked away, this time playing "Baby, Come Back". Arriving at Mikaela's house, Sam advanced a step towards her by stating that he didn't believe her to be shallow at all, that there was "more than meets the eye" with her. After she left, Sam quietly enthused that he loved his car.

Trivia

  • According to an article on Edmunds.com, the film makers wanted Bumblebee's original Earth form to be the 1976 iteration of the Camaro because it was the worst Camaro possible that also had chrome bumpers.
  • The same article indicates that the 1976 Camaros used in the film were all purchased via online auction for under $6000 each, one for less than $2000. That one didn't run.
  • One of the 1976 Camaros was sold on eBay. The bidding ended on July 18, 2007; the final price was $40,100.01.
  • The Bumblebee computer-generated model consisted of 7608 individual parts, 1,511,727 polygons, 19,722 rig nodes, and 8094 texture maps. The volume of all the pieces came to 1069.01 cubic feet.[3]
  • Bumblebee stands approximately 16 feet tall, according to the official game strategy guide.
  • The 2008 Concept Camaro used for Bumblebee in the first movie was built by Saleen in 30 days, using a heavily modified 2006 Pontiac GTO body as the basis. The '08 Camaro was not in production at the time that the first film was being made, hence an identical mock-up was needed to fill the role.[5]

  • Bumblebee is equipped with a pair of arm-mounted electrical "stingers."[6] The stingers were ultimately not featured in the movies, but influenced other media.
  • Speaking of weapons, for someone whose main job is being subtle, Bumblebee is quite well armed, with a cannon powerful enough to rattle Brawl and a ring-shaped light missile launcher in either shoulder. He is also a capable close-combat fighter, as seen in his fight against Barricade and Rampage.
  • The Bumblebee Camaro '09 toy's blade weapon might be influenced by the arm-mounted stingers from early concepts.
  • According to the prequel comic by IDW Publishing, Megatron ripped out and crushed Bumblebee's voice capacitor during the battle at Tyger Pax back on Cybertron. Hardtop's toy bio claims the damage came from a shot fired by Hardtop. In the film itself, Ratchet only states to Sam that Bumblebee's "vocal processors were damaged in battle" and he was "still working on them" after firing a single plasma beam at Bumblebee's throat; by the end of all the conflict (the climax of the film proper), Bumblebee has regained his ability to speak. Although it was not confirmed on-screen, screenwriter Roberto Orci did confirm off-screen[1] that Ratchet's (regenerative) beam was indeed the reason.   • Although unexplained in the films, Bumblebee's vehicle mode changes appearance subtly between Transformers (2007) and Revenge of the Fallen. This is probably because of product placement: Bumblebee's old alternate mode was an unavailable concept Camaro, while in Revenge he uses what seems to be the new Z/28 Camaro which would have entered mass production. Said car has now been canceled.
  • Screenwriter Roberto Orci, when asked, admitted there had been plans to have Bumblebee speak in Revenge of the Fallen; however, ultimately they liked his "musical ability" too much, and Michael Bay wanted to focus more on Skids and Mudflap, since he thought kids would like the two characters.[7]
  • Bumblebee's license plate number is 4NZ2454, registered in California.[8]
  • According to the "25 Years of Transformers" feature on the ROTF DVD, Bumblebee was at one point intended to transform into a black Chevy Camaro covertible.
